## Changelog — Tidemark Widget 3.2

Defaults changed. Read before touching anything.

- Refresh interval now hourly, not every 15 min. Harbor feeds from the Pellisport aggregator throttle aggressive polling.
- Lunar-offset correction is on by default. Disable only for legacy Kestrel Bay deployments.
- Chart units default to metric. The imperial fallback flag is deprecated and will be removed in 3.4.
- Cache eviction is now time-based, not size-based.

New installs should start from the default configuration values listed below.

config for kahap-taweg:
oliox:
  pin: 8609
  tenant: casath
  seal: seal_632a4a6f
  metrics_host: metrics.oliox.nelvrogrid.example
  standby_team: keleth
  escalation: briiel-oliwyn
  nonce: e2397c

## Runbook: Pinning Policy

Quick refresher for new folks: every release of Lanternbox ships with fully pinned deps — no ranges, no floating tags. Regenerate the lockfile, run the audit job, and get one reviewer sign-off. Once the lockfile is frozen, sign the manifest before tagging. Use the release signing key shown just below.

release key, hadug-kawef: bky13_mPGeFZeR1GZ1G

Ticket: Missed pick-up — archive film reels

The scheduled collection of six nitrate-safe film reels from Bramleigh Hall for the Oakenshore Archive did not occur yesterday; the Larkspur Courier van never arrived. The reels remain in the climate-controlled anteroom, crated and sealed, and must not be moved to the open dock. A replacement collection is booked for tomorrow between 09:00 and 11:00. Receiving staff should verify the crate seals on arrival. For the courier hand-over, apply the confidential instruction that follows below.

dispatch memo: the eliath belael courier leaves the praox ledger at gate 8841 under passcode 017589